Mid-America Apartment Communities (MAA) was downgraded to Underperform from Sector Perform by Scotiabank on May 14, 2026, with a price target cut to $120 from $138. The move reflects expectations for weaker rent growth in Sunbelt markets, where significant overbuilding may take years to absorb, potentially keeping occupancy below pre-pandemic levels.

(NYSE: MAA) to Underperform from its previous Sector Perform rating. The firm also lowered its price target on the stock to $120 from $138. According to the analyst, the downgrade is driven by expectations for “subpar” rent growth across key Sunbelt markets where MAA has significant exposure. The report highlighted that substantial overbuilding in many of those markets could take several years to be fully absorbed. This supply pressure, the analyst noted, may keep occupancy rates below pre-COVID trends, thereby limiting the potential for stronger rent increases. The news was reported by Vardah Gill on Yahoo Finance on May 25, 2026. MAA currently offers an annual dividend yield of 4.66%, which has drawn attention from income-focused investors. The stock was previously included in a list of high-yield stocks for lasting retirement income.

Key takeaways from this development suggest that MAA’s near-term growth trajectory may be constrained by market-specific headwinds. The Sunbelt region has experienced a wave of new apartment construction in recent years, and the analyst’s comments indicate that the resulting oversupply could persist for a prolonged period. For investors monitoring the multifamily real estate sector, this downgrade signals a cautious outlook for operators with heavy Sunbelt concentration. Occupancy levels below pre-COVID benchmarks could pressure net operating income and limit the company’s ability to raise rents meaningfully. Additionally, the revised price target of $120 implies a potential downside from prior expectations, though actual share price movements would depend on broader market conditions and the pace of supply absorption. The downgrade from Sector Perform to Underperform underscores the analyst’s view that the risk-reward balance for MAA may have shifted unfavorably relative to peers.

From an investment perspective, the downgrade on MAA highlights how regional supply dynamics can affect apartment real estate investment trusts (REITs) even when the broader housing market remains stable. Investors may need to weigh the stock’s attractive dividend yield against the potential for slower earnings growth in the near term. The timeline for Sunbelt market recovery remains uncertain. If absorption of new supply proceeds more slowly than anticipated, MAA’s occupancy and rent growth could remain below historical trends for several years. Conversely, if demand accelerates or new construction slows, the outlook might improve sooner. This situation also underscores the importance of monitoring local market conditions for REITs with concentrated geographic exposure. For those considering positions in the multifamily sector, the cautious stance from Scotiabank may serve as a reminder to evaluate supply-demand balances in target markets.
